Michelle Westford is a stand up comedian who writes and delivers a friendly, observational & slick-happy humor.
Michelle has entertained audiences with her stand up comedy from Seattle to Reno and Los Angeles. Along with being a cast member in many taped & live sketches, Michelle has been seen welcoming & warming up the studio audience with stand up comedy for filming of the Seattle based sketch comedy show The[206], UpLate NW and as a sketch writer for the award winning show Biz Kid$ on PBS.
One of her most treasured comedy moments was being pulled up on the Jay Leno Tonight Show stage to improv with their warm up comedian and using her auctioneering skills to sell a banjo with Steve Martin.
